Index of /Image/fjzyyb/Firm
Name
Last modified
Size
Description
Parent Directory
-
1389001014132328827.jpg
2015-08-11 15:59
61K
1389001014230389273.jpg
2015-08-11 15:59
11K
1389001024276598784.jpg
2015-08-11 15:59
26K
1389001024311235346.jpg
2015-08-11 15:59
10K